I pollinated some plants a couple of years(?) ago. I got a butt load of seeds out of the plants. These that I have growing now are just to prove to myself that the seeds are viable. They are. I planted 4 seeds and got six seedlings. Weird. 2 of the seeds must have had twin embryos. I don’t know what that means as far as the end result(hermies, mutants, super plants, normal plants, awful plants). My plan is to veg these until they go to their foster home but I may keep a couple and plant them outside. A friend has a breeding program going so he is the foster farmer. I planted the seeds Feb 18th so they are about 6 weeks old. I am not taking good care of them. They are in a freaking box in my furnace room with a 2 bulb t5 light.

So these seeds are from a ‘Lemon’ cross and a ‘Grape’ cross. The Lemon was (Lemon Larry x Lemon Thai) x Oregon Lemons and was the male. The Grape was (Gorilla Grape x Grape Stomper) x Grape Kush and (obviously) was the female. Both are from a former member gifted me from another former member.

Transplanted from 2 cup pots to 2 quart pots today. I am using some Fox Farm soil(don’t remember what kind and I don’t feel like going downstairs to check). I have been giving them Kelp4Less Grow Part A and B as well as Extreme Blend probably once a week.

Clones are still looking ok. No wilting. I spritzed them once. No additional water. Both of those approaches are new for me. I have been told that misting too frequently makes it so the cuttings do not need roots(misting can also leach nutes from what I have read/been told).

Almost 2 weeks from my lame cheapskate cloning attempt(dirt, a 5 gallon bucket, some plastic wrap, tape and 2 2700k 13 watt cfl’s). Looks like it is working. One clone is droopy but the others look healthy. One even has done roots visible. I guess not caring works for me…
